Knowledge of lab process and safety training is desired also. Each time blood is taken as a sample, care must be given to how this is done and the way the equipment is disposed of. An accident using a needle or with the tagging of samples can have awful effects. This is often either to the phlebotomist or the patient. Phlebotomy refers to the procedure for drawing blood for a diagnostic sample by making an incision in a vein by means of a needle and syringe.
